This video is a lecture given by Dr. Rebecca Rogers, the Ulf Holmstein Lecturer for Ayuga. The lecture is titled "Curing Pelvic Floor Disorders in 2040, Measuring Sex and Other Aspects of Pelvic Floor Function." Dr. Rogers discusses the definition of cure and the importance of measuring outcomes that matter to patients. She shares her experience in treating pelvic floor disorders and highlights the need for more comprehensive measures beyond anatomy to assess patient satisfaction and well-being. She also discusses the development of the PISQ-IR, a sexual function measure sponsored by Ayuga, and the challenges of integrating patient-reported outcomes into clinical practice. Dr. Rogers emphasizes the importance of patient-centered care and the need for better tools and integration of outcomes measures in electronic medical records. The lecture concludes with a call for the future of pelvic floor disorder treatment to prioritize what truly matters to patients.
